December 1

Published in On this Day listing

  • 1919 Lady (Nancy) Astor became the first woman to take a seat in the Westminster House of Commons.
  • 1956 Ronnie Delaney (21) won a gold medal for Ireland in the 1,500 metres at the Olympic Games in Melbourne, the first since Bob Tisdall in 1932.
  • 1666  Sir James Ware (72), antiquary and historiographer, author notably of Ancient Irish histories (1633), died.
